Transaction 58e9971e0c1950b326562876846214541b0790b13372c7cf5a4fcc52ba206690
1 Input
2 Outputs
- 58e9971e0c1950b326562876846214541b0790b13372c7cf5a4fcc52ba206690:0
- 58e9971e0c1950b326562876846214541b0790b13372c7cf5a4fcc52ba206690:1
value 13314780909
address 13WLMeyibAioKK4pJUbe42qFhm4PgtHGnH
value 1019000
address 189iFeV2re6TKrodsKz46duaAjeNfTFpRN